" I have come to think of the way of God as the way of forgetting. The more closely we meditate on our lost moments, the further they flee from our grasp. They come back to us only obliquely, in glimpses, moments snatched from the dreaming, undeserved moments of Grace. Once we are able to let ourselves forget, then we are on our way to being free from the cry which we are scarcely able to choke back with every breath. Free to forgive ourselves for those immense crimes which we are always on the point of remembering. The meaning of our dead childhoods eludes us. We have overheard only the last part of the sentence. The same few images hang in the air, a cipher, tantalising.

I too have found my freedom in celibacy, in my disenchantment with the way of the lover. As Dieppe herself said, after it happened: 'I am just not interested in having certain experiences any more.' "


-Nightpictures, Rod Jones
